In this 20VC interview, Arvind Jain, founder of Glean, shares insights on the enterprise AI landscape, emphasizing that open-source models now handle over 90% of enterprise use cases, driven largely by cost pressures. He argues that model companies like OpenAI and Anthropic are becoming commoditized and should be seen as assets rather than threats, though he acknowledges fierce competition, especially from Microsoft Copilot's bundling strategy, which consumption-based pricing may disrupt. Jain critiques current AI ROI, noting clear gains in customer support but limited impact on overall product shipping speed, citing his own costly AI triage agent at $1 million monthly. He challenges the trend of shrinking teams, advocating for growth to outcompete rivals, while admitting pressure to be less disciplined in a market land grab. He predicts a shift toward composite roles and the elimination of specialized roles like data analysts. On sovereignty, he notes strong desire but slow progress, with only China producing major models, and anticipates US efforts to promote open-source development. Jain advises founders to focus on solving problems rather than fearing model providers, and reflects on the unglamorous, stressful nature of being a CEO, emphasizing continuous dissatisfaction and mission-driven persistence. The discussion underscores a transformative, uncertain period in enterprise AI, balancing innovation, cost, and strategic control.

Speaker 2For those that don't know, can you provide a 60 second summary on what Glean is and how you work?
Speaker 1So Glean is an enterprise AI company. We started as a search company for businesses. So help an employee quickly find information that they need. You know, that's sort of built across one of 100 or 1000 different systems inside their company. So that was sort of like how we started the Google. It's a Google for your work life. But then over time as AI models got better, so it evolved into an AI platform. So today the way to think about Glean is that first, it's a superset of ChatGPT, Cloud, Gemini, all of those combined into one product experience. It's a coworker for your employees. And it's connected to all of your company's context, how work happens inside your company. So Mr.

Speaker 2Before we get to AI not working, because I think it's probably one of the most important questions. There's a whole separate segment. Do you think they're right to be afraid of the frontier model providers eating their lunch or not?
Speaker 1Well, yeah, I mean, depending on the enterprise, yes. Well, look, like, you know, if we are talking about fundamentally changing how people work and if we are saying that majority of the work that we do today is going to be done by an agent which is fully powered by one of these frontier model companies, then in some sense, like you've now transferred a lot of your operations to these technology providers, this is more than technology dependence. This is actually real sort of operational dependence on the on the companies that are actually running those agents for you. It's actually interesting. If you think about how work happens over time, like, you know, there is, you know, like when you initially do a task for the first time, maybe you'll document a process like, you know, what are the 10 steps you need to take to actually complete some piece of work and then over time people start to sort of optimize and tweak that process. A lot of it never gets documented and you just you sort of based on doing this work one over again, you now built all these learnings that you apply in real time to do this work. In the future, all of that institutional learning is actually going to accumulate in that agent that is doing that work. So if you don't have any control on running that agent yourself, you don't own the learning that it actually gains over the years, then you're basically fully dependent on these AI companies, you know, to do, you know, to get your work done. So like it's absolutely, I think there's a fundamental question in front of enterprises today, how do they actually use these AI technologies but still retain control? And all the compounding learnings that happen with AI, they belong to the enterprises.
Speaker 2Are you seeing enterprise customers route away from frontier model providers towards open source?
Speaker 1That's something that's happening now. So I think we are at a real inflection point with open source. Part of it, you know, like you're waiting on the open source models to actually get better. You know, the desire has been there for many, many years. Nobody, there's no enterprise, you know, that we talk to which is OK with saying that, hey, look, I can get my work done with OpenAI or with Anthropic and I'm good. Everybody wants to make sure that they are in control of their destiny, that they get to use many of these models. And now, given that AI has become so expensive, people hear stories all the time about companies, you know, coming up with a annual budget for AI and they run past that, like, you know, within a month or two.
Speaker 2Poor CFOs.
Speaker 1So that sort of, that has really accelerated that, that desire, you know, for open source. Because, you know, and that coupled with the fact that We now have really good models in open source. What do they care about?
Speaker 2Do they care about cost? Do they care about ownership in terms of their data staying on-prem in models that they actually can have visibility on? What is it?
Speaker 1I think right now the open source drive is coming from the cost point of view. There are certain businesses, of course, that have the requirements to actually keep all the inferencing workload within their own private data centers. When AI just came, companies were a lot more afraid of getting their data outside of their own control and model companies training with their data. But that sort of is a fear that it's no longer there. People believe that the model companies are going to be responsible and not train their models on enterprise data so long as I've signed up for the right kind of contract. So right now the drive is coming from cost.

Speaker 2Another competitive element that you face for getting the model providers, it's like, actually, you have Microsoft, you know, Microsoft have made a phenomenal business on the back of creating a 70% as good product, but bundling it into a bundle for enterprises, and then selling it with a nice sticker on it. How do you think about the bundling pressure from a Microsoft co-pilot as a competitive threat?
Speaker 1Well, for us, they are one of our most significant competitors. And the bundling strategy actually works. And you have to fight, you know, against that. I mean, there's luckily, like, you know, there's always been room for best of breed, you know, software and, you know, like, all customers think of us exactly like that. If you are trying to actually bring a great search product, if you're trying to build a horizontal comprehensive AI platform, they know that, you know, we do do it better. So companies are willing to invest on top of that, like, you know, as part of the bundled product suite from Microsoft. But the other thing, like, you know, is actually, is maybe making bundling not as effective of a strategy anymore, is the fact that AI is moving towards consumption based models. So once you move towards consumption, there's no inherent bundling advantage, because, you know, like, and as a business, I can get six tools, and I let the users choose where they want to do their work, wherever they do their work, I have to pay for it for that particular unit of work. So consumption can ultimately break that bundling strategy.

Speaker 2We mentioned Alex Copson at the beginning and I interrupted you and said, let's, before we dive to like, we're not getting value, I think 2026 H2 and 2027 is the year where everyone goes, oh, hang on a minute. Is this spend generating output or return of ROI? How do we think about the return on investment that enterprises are getting? And is Alex Cop right in saying everyone's going, what the fuck? Where's, where's my return?
Speaker 1I would say that there is pockets of value realisation today. For example, take customer support as a vertical. I think there it was easy to measure productivity. You could actually say that. Like, you know, your company is support agent resolves 10 cases a day and now they're able to do 12 because of AI. So you could see that in, you know, like a very concrete measure of productivity increase. And that's it. That's the use case, you know, where AI is actually pretty good because a lot of like, you know, that time that is spent by the support teams is about reading knowledge and then summarising it to your customers. So, so there are definitely areas where there is clear value realisation and, and, you know, and enterprises are feeling good. Some other ones are more complex. For example, I think the majority of the AI spend right now is on coding. And you know that the coding as a practice has changed. Most developers now actually use AI to write code. They're not writing it by hand anymore. In some ways, you can say that, yes, AI made a big impact, but are they shipping the products faster or not? And that's where we hear most of the companies saying that, no, that the actual shipping speed of products has not increased, even though coding speed increased significantly. Because I know that's only a small part of overall shipping a product. Has your shipping speed increased? I would say it's hard to actually measure. That's the challenge. Because engineering productivity is one of the most difficult things to measure. It's the fuzziest of the jobs out there. If you look at some of the metrics like lines of code written, of course, we're writing way more lines of code now. But if you look at, are we shipping features at a greater pace? Yes, we are. But it's a result also of we have a larger team, we have a team that is more tenured than it was before. So sometimes it's hard to tease it apart. But with that, what do we do as a company? Speaker 2we are just going to keep investing. What percent of Glean code, say, do you think is written by AI?
Speaker 1Now it's probably about almost 100%. Nobody's actually writing the initial code by hand anymore. Yeah, so almost all the code is being written with AI, but we actually enforce human reviews. So you cannot actually generate tons of AI code and then just check it in the repos. We're probably more conservative than most other companies. There was, in fact, a discussion inside the company that, well, now AI can write so much code, and the real bottleneck has shifted from the person who writes the code to person who has to review. And so there was a proposal to actually eliminate code reviews. And many companies are doing that. They just let AI write the code and directly get submitted into the repos. So there was a discussion inside the company that
Speaker 2said, well, if you have to have a stringent code review process, it almost removes the point of having a fastened code development process. Yeah, it's true. But I think what it is doing
Speaker 1right now is, we're still in the learning phase of using AI effectively, thinking about long-term ramifications of it. Because when you write code, for example, with AI, you can write a million lines of code, but it becomes incredibly hard to actually maintain it and understand it and manage it over time. Is that not what you're saying?
Speaker 2Is that not what AI does, though? You have AI that does refactoring, and AI that does security, and AI that does...
Speaker 1Yeah, the only thing is that it's not that perfect right now. I think that right now, we're willing to pay the cost of reviewing the code. So we're still faster than before, because the writing part is actually much faster now. And the person who writes is the one who actually does the first review.
Speaker 2So when you say AI ROI is really a throughput problem, what does that mean?
Speaker 1The first thing that we have to do is make sure that you are able to bring the right context to these AI agents. If you think about most enterprises today, the way they're rolling out AI is that they actually just throw it into the system and connect AI with all of enterprise systems in a rudimentary manner using MCP servers. And now you're letting any piece of work that you are trying to do with AI, you're letting the models sort of brute force their way into trying to figure out and assemble the right raw materials that they need to complete the task and then do it. And in this sort of in this mode, AI is super slow. It takes a lot of time to actually just assemble the basic information it needs to do the work. It also becomes very, very costly because most of the tokens are being burned just trying to assemble the right context for that given task. And you're trying to sort of use AI for things where it's not even good at or needed. So instead, what we talk about is to make AI really perform and deliver, you have to sort of invest around it. You have to make sure that you provided the right context so that it can actually work faster at a lower cost. What does it mean to invest

Speaker 1I'll give an example. We had this cool triage agent for engineering. We have 15 people team on call team that their work was to actually triage every single production issue that happens, like any system alerts, things that are going. And we built this agent that actually now is taking care of like 95% of those issues automatically for them. But even there is actually doing it a cost, which is actually questionable. Like, you know, is it actually more efficient than humans? We were spending a million dollars a month on that particular agent. And that was actually more than the cost of a million a month. Yeah. Are you buying Cristiano Ronaldo? What are you doing? Well, I mean, the air costs are like that. I mean, it is quite expensive.

Speaker 2unfortunately. When you think about token spend internally, how did you sit down and think about it as a team and sitting with your CFO? How did you go through the decision of how to think about token budgeting? Well, I think we did probably what most
Speaker 1companies did, which is we didn't do anything. I think like, you know, because we were in this phase of let people figure out what they can do with this tech.
Speaker 2And what did you see? People went crazy. People didn't adopt it. What happened?
Speaker 1There's a power law, like, you know, in our company and also at all of our customers, you will see some people who spend $10,000 or $15,000 in tokens every month. And then you have others who are spending $20. One thing is interesting though, that everybody has embraced AI to some degree. Like everybody is using the basic, you know, as I mentioned before, the number one application of our use case for AI today in the world is information seeking, question answering, and everybody's doing that. Like everybody on the team, in our team, as well as our customers, they're all doing that. Everybody's asking questions. Everybody's getting some basic summarization information synthesis going. But the advanced use cases are limited to like 5% of the employee base.

Speaker 1would be tough yeah yeah yeah but but like you know even before that i think the it just hasn't happened right like you know the only country in the world you know that has produced models outside of u.s is china yeah and then of course like maybe a little bit in
Speaker 2like you know france with mistral is that simply an incentive problem the lack of open source community in the u.s and why we don't have any u.s open source to real degree and substantiveness
Speaker 1no i think the there is good good open source community in the u.s in many other areas well i mean what open model from the u.s no there's no yeah you're right that we don't have open models but it's not because open source has as a movement as a dollar you know as a concept is weak in the u.s it's actually quite strong it's probably if you think about models they require a lot of upfront investment which is not open source friendly in many ways a lot of open source software has been skunkworks developers just getting no funding associated with them and they still get something built they couldn't build models that way and so that's why like you know naturally this thing didn't work out and you you know you need these techniques you know where like super high investment is not needed
